On Vumatel I would recommend Supersonic by the tests that have been posted. CISP is also good.

Basically boils down to one thing. Installation fee. If you want it free from the very first month and 1 month free fibre then Supersonic is your option. The installation fee has a 24 month claw back pro rata so the longer you stay the less you pay but you can cancel any time.

CISP you would need to pay Vumatel for the installation and then CISP monthly.

Both have pretty decent networks so you can't go wrong either way.

Well yes you will be saving a bit.

Take R1725 / 24 is ~R72 that will be deducted on a monthly basis basically. So the longer you stay the less you have to pay back when canceling. You also get the 1st month free so there is that saving too so depending on which package you take the free month could also be seen as an installation fee offset should you wish to cancel after say 2 months.

They supply a free to use Zyxel router but you can also use your own router if you want.
